Introduction

Allenhouse Public School – Khalasi Line, located in Kanpur, offers a CBSE-based curriculum with Cambridge IGCSE components for Pre-Primary through Sr. Secondary, with Science, Commerce, and Humanities streams. The program balances STEM with humanities and arts, and emphasizes 21st‑century skills. Learning is enriched through activities, field trips, nature walks, and art‑integrated syllabi, and focuses on critical and creative thinking. Electives include Fashion Studies, Legal Studies, Mass Media Studies, and Artificial Intelligence to broaden subject choices. The Achiever curriculum model covers eight dimensions, including Advanced Academics, Health & Wellness Empowered, Excellence In Communication, and a Robust Sports Program. Founded in 2006 by Mr. Mukhtarul Amin, the school aims to blend Indian cultural values with an international outlook and carries the motto Educate, Enrich, Empower. It connects with international programs such as the International Award for Young People, Cambridge English Language Assessment, and the British Council‑International Award. Fees

Annual tuition at Allenhouse Public School – Khalasi Line ranges from INR 121,940 to INR 146,500 for 2026/27.

Application / Admission fees

- Classes I to IX: Admission fee Rs 30,000 payable once at the time of admission.
- Class XI: Admission fee Rs 35,000 payable once at the time of admission.
- Admission fees are collected at the time of joining and the admission fee is non‑refundable.

Tuition (composite) fees — per term and per year (session 2026–2027)

All published tuition amounts are listed as Quarterly (per term) composite fees. Annual figures below equal the quarterly fee multiplied by four.

- Class I: Per term Rs 30,485; Per year Rs 121,940.
- Class II: Per term Rs 30,985; Per year Rs 123,940.
- Class III: Per term Rs 30,485; Per year Rs 121,940.
- Class IV: Per term Rs 31,025; Per year Rs 124,100.
- Class V: Per term Rs 31,850; Per year Rs 127,400.
- Class VI: Per term Rs 31,340; Per year Rs 125,360.
- Class VII: Per term Rs 32,025; Per year Rs 128,100.
- Class VIII: Per term Rs 30,660; Per year Rs 122,640.
- Class IX: Per term Rs 32,125; Per year Rs 128,500.
- Class X: Per term Rs 32,125; Per year Rs 128,500.
- Class XI (Commerce & Humanities): Per term Rs 34,850; Per year Rs 139,400.
- Class XI (Science): Per term Rs 36,625; Per year Rs 146,500.
- Class XII (Commerce & Humanities): Per term Rs 33,985; Per year Rs 135,940.
- Class XII (Science): Per term Rs 35,750; Per year Rs 143,000.

Billing schedule and payment terms

- Fees are billed on a quarterly basis (the published amounts are Quarterly/term fees).
- Admission fees are payable once at the time of admission. Quarterly tuition is payable in each term as per the school's fee challan/ERP billing.

Boarding / hostel fees

- The Khalasi Lines campus operates as a day school; no boarding/hostel facility is provided for students (therefore no boarding fees are charged for this campus).

Other costs and typical additional charges

- The published amounts are shown as “Composite Fees.” Separate, itemised charges for items such as uniforms, textbooks, transport, activity fees or exam fees are not shown in the quarterly composite table. Where applicable, parents should expect additional one‑time or recurring charges for uniforms, books, and certain co‑curricular activities. The school operates an organised bus/transport service with published routes.

Refund information

- The admission fee is stated as non‑refundable. No separate, itemised public refund schedule for term tuition is published in the fee schedule document; standard practice is that admission fee is non‑refundable.

Fee payment options and how fees are collected

- Fee collection and registration are managed through the school's online/ERP system (the school lists an ERP/online registration portal and generates fee challans for parents). Parents use the school's ERP/parent portal and generated challans for fee settlement.

Quick practical points for parents

- All amounts shown above are in Indian Rupees (Rs) and are the school's published Quarterly (per term) composite fees for session 2026–2027; annual totals are calculated as four times the quarterly fee.
- Admission fees are payable once at joining (Rs 30,000 for Classes I–IX; Rs 35,000 for Class XI) and are recorded separately from the quarterly composite fee.

Admissions

Admissions

1. Registration is the first step. The prospectus given during registration provides complete information about the school system and admission details for Allenhouse Khalasi Line. The registration initiates the admission process for Classes I–IX and XI. The process follows the admission criteria of Allenhouse Khalasi Line.

2. Admission to Classes I and above is based on the result of an admission test conducted by the school and the interaction of shortlisted students and parents with the principal, as per the Allenhouse Khalasi Line admission process. The admission test result and interaction with the principal determine eligibility according to the admission criteria. The process follows the admission criteria of Allenhouse Khalasi Line.

3. The date, time, and syllabus for the admission test will be intimated at the time of registration itself per the admission criteria. The notification is provided during registration. The process aligns with the criteria outlined for Khalasi Line.

4. The result of the admission test will be informed telephonically. Shortlisted candidates are contacted by telephone to convey outcomes. The communication completes the admission decision.

5. Documents required at the time of registration / admission include: filled up the form and two passport-size photographs; Attested copy of the Birth Certificate of the Child; Original birth certificate for verification; Report card of previous class (Attested); Transfer Certificate (original) to be submitted within one month from the admission date; Original Character certificate for class VII and above; Copy of the Aadhar Card of the Child and the Parents; Caste certificate for SC / ST / OBC / EWS; Certificate for disability, if any; PEN (Permanent Education Number).
